Issued in 1967, this 140 Lire stamp from the Republic of San Marino features the delicate Gentiana asclepiadea, known as the Willow Gentian. The vivid blue blossoms stand against the backdrop of San Marino’s ancient fortress walls, symbolizing the harmony between nature and heritage. Part of a beautifully designed flora series, it showcases San Marino’s commitment to celebrating Alpine and Apennine wildflowers through artful philately.
